Chital Mari is a Rural village located in Naduar, Sonitpur, Assam.
The total population of Chital Mari is 1,423.
Chital Mari village comprises 275 households.
The literacy rate in Chital Mari is 72.7%. Among the literate population of 899, there are 524 literate males and 375 literate females.
In Chital Mari, there are 731 males and 692 females, with a sex ratio of 947 females per 1000 males.
There are 187 children (13.1% of population), comprising 88 boys and 99 girls.
The total number of workers in Chital Mari is 553, with 330 main workers and 223 marginal workers.
In Chital Mari, there are 82 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(42 males, 40 females) and 10 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(5 males, 5 females).
Chital Mari is located in Assam state, Sonitpur district, and falls under Naduar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 286436 and LGD code is 286436.
